Why Car Accidents In Key Largo Are Often More Complex Than Expected
Car accidents in the Upper Florida Keys present challenges that many injured people do not anticipate. As Key Largo car accident lawyers, we regularly see cases complicated by heavy tourist traffic, rental vehicles, and drivers insured under out-of-state policies. These factors can slow down investigations and make insurance claims more difficult to resolve.
Key Largo’s layout adds another layer of complexity. With Overseas Highway (US-1) acting as the primary roadway, crashes often lead to significant congestion, limited detours, and delayed emergency response times. Accidents near marinas, resorts, and busy commercial areas may involve sudden stops, pedestrians, or distracted drivers unfamiliar with local traffic patterns.
Because these cases often involve multiple parties and insurance carriers, they require careful attention from the start. Understanding the local conditions and anticipating common insurance obstacles allows us to protect our clients’ claims and work toward fair outcomes without unnecessary delays.
Damages Available After A Car Accident In Key Largo
When someone is injured in a crash, the financial and personal impact often extends far beyond the initial medical visit. Our team looks at the full scope of how an accident affects your life—not just what you are dealing with today, but what you may face months or years down the road.
Our goal is to pursue compensation that reflects the true cost of your economic and non-economic damages. Both are important, and both deserve careful documentation and consideration.
Economic Damages
Economic damages cover the tangible, out-of-pocket losses caused by a car accident. These are often easier to document but can add up quickly, especially in serious injury cases. We commonly pursue compensation for:
- Emergency care, hospital stays, and follow-up medical treatment
- Future medical needs, including therapy or ongoing care
- Lost wages while you are unable to work
- Reduced earning capacity if injuries affect your ability to return to your job
- Vehicle repair or replacement and related transportation costs
We work to gather records, bills, and employer documentation to ensure these losses are fully accounted for.
Non-Economic Damages
Not all harm from a car accident comes with a receipt. Non-economic damages address how the injuries change your daily life and overall well-being. Depending on the circumstances, these damages may include:
- Physical pain and discomfort
- Emotional distress and mental anguish
- Loss of enjoyment of life
- The long-term impact of permanent or disabling injuries
These losses are deeply personal, which is why we take the time to understand how the accident has affected you and your family. By presenting a clear picture of both the financial and personal consequences, we work to pursue compensation that truly reflects what you have been through.
What To Do After A Car Accident In Key Largo
The actions you take after a crash can affect both your recovery and your ability to pursue compensation. Keeping the following steps in mind can help protect your health and your rights.
- Get medical care right away. Some injuries are not obvious at first. Seeing a doctor creates a record of your injuries and helps prevent insurance companies from questioning your condition later.
- Report the crash and gather information. Call law enforcement to make an accident report. If you can, take photos of the scene and collect witness contact information.
- Be careful with insurance calls. Insurance adjusters may contact you quickly. Statements or early settlement offers may not reflect the full impact of your injuries.
- Watch the statute of limitations. Florida law gives you two years to file a car accident claim. Waiting too long can cost you the right to pursue compensation and make evidence harder to obtain.
Taking these steps early can help put you in a stronger position after a car accident and reduce unnecessary obstacles as you move forward.
